Across TCGA patient cohorts, PTPRE protein abundance is significantly associated with the RNA expression of many other genes, with 15,001 significant associations in total. LSCC shows the largest number of these associations.

The most reproducible PTPRE-associated genes across cancer lineages are DOK3, CD226, and IL21R. Each is linked with PTPRE in more than 6 cancer types. Because this analysis shows association rather than direction, both PTPRE-to-partner and partner-to-PTPRE results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, PTPRE versus DOK3 in OV, with a Pearson correlation of 0.48.
